    What were the three animals used in the 1912 political conventions?

    Question #19973. Asked by Maggie.

    elburcher

    The Democratic Donkey(Candidate Woodrow Wilson)
    The Republican Elephant (Candidate William Howrd Taft)
    And The Bull Moos'er(Bull Moose Party) Bull Moose
    (Candidate Theodore Roosevelt). In the 1912 election
    Theodore Roosevelt came in second behind winner Woodrow Wilson
